Output 8627132065a4582d5e38cc27eed6387d9760c8a8243304178affbbf3344ef7e7:0

value
462882
script pubkey
OP_0 OP_PUSHBYTES_20 d25e1076dbd3733c6a04740611df11eec90bf7f4
address
bc1q6f0pqakm6denc6sywsrprhc3amyshal5fdgysa
transaction
8627132065a4582d5e38cc27eed6387d9760c8a8243304178affbbf3344ef7e7
confirmations
59598
spent
true